Before the interview I posted on the Doll Diaries Facebook page asking our fans what they want to know about Jade, and here is what we found out.

Jade Pettyjohn First the basics – Jade Pettyjohn is an 11 year old actress who is going into 7th grade. She says she was very shy as a little girl but knew she wanted to act. Her Mom had a friend in the modeling business and they thought that would be a great place for Jade to start getting used to the camera. Jade really wanted to act, though! She began acting in commercials and TV around the age of 7 and now that she is getting older, she enjoys the modeling in addition to her acting again.

Sue & Erin: Do you have any American Girl dolls?

Jade: Yes, I have three. I have a MyAG doll that my aunt gave me years ago but she doesn’t really look like me. Then when we finished filming the movie, American Girl gave each of us a Julie doll and when McKenna came out, we got her as well.

Laura, Ashley, Caroline, Diana & Rose: Are you a gymnast in real life and when did you start?

Jade: I have taken some basic gymnastics lessons – and can do things like cartwheels, but my background is more dance related. When I auditioned it said they were looking for dancers, so I figured it was a dance part. We did about three weeks of training in gymnastics and working with our stunt doubles before filming started.

Natalie: Do you do any other sports?

Jade: I like to play basketball, but I don’t play on a team and I dance.

Anngel: How long has your stunt double been doing gymnastics?

Jade: My stunt double was amazing! She has been doing gymnastics her whole life. She is a competitive gymnast in Canada (that’s where we did the filming) and so were most of the other stunt doubles and extra gymnasts in the movie.

Linda & Cindy: What was the biggest challenge you faced while filming the movie?

Jade: Gymnastics is a whole new world for me, really. The hardest part was learning how to walk like a gymnast, act like a gymnast and learn the routines. Once I got the hang of it though it was fun. The wheelchair scene was also a lot of hard work, but was a fun challenge.

Kelly: Speaking of wheelchairs, do you have any personal friends who use a wheelchair.

Jade: Yes. And while Ysa and I were getting gymnastics training before they started filming, Kerris (who plays Josie) was getting wheelchair training.

Melina: What was it like wearing a cast and using crutches during the filming of the movie?

Jade: I actually thought it was fun using the crutches and the cast was like a space boot – I could still walk in it. The only thing was that it would get really hot on that one foot since we were filming in the summer.

Pressley: What was your favorite scene in the movie?

Jade: The Regional Gymnastics Competition. It felt like a real gymnastics meet – there was so much energy in the air. All the gymnasts were so excited to be in the movie and it was so much fun to film.

Nicole: Did you make any new close friends from doing the movie?

Jade: Definitely! Yes! I went out to dinner a few nights ago with Ysa and Kerris – so we are still very close. And I still keep in touch with a lot of the girls who played our stunt doubles and some of the gymnasts via Facebook and Skype.

Kiera & Alyssa: Do you think you would like to be in another American Girl movie?

Jade: Well, of course, if they asked me to! But I think you can only be in one.

Char: Will we be seeing you in any upcoming TV or movie roles?

Jade: Yes, I have some things in the works, but I can’t really talk about them yet.

Alexandra: What advice do you have for aspiring actresses?

Jade: Understand your script and know what all the words really mean so you can deliver your lines with the right tone and emotion.

Char: A few weeks ago you attended the US Olympic Trials for Gymnastics, did a special pre-screening of the movie and signed autographs. How did you like that and who is your favorite gymnast?

Jade: It was a lot of fun!! I got to watch both nights of the women’s competition and I would say my favorites are Gabby Douglas and Jordyn Wieber.
